当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器搭建及配置方案,基于云服务器的搭建及配置方案详解

云服务器搭建及配置方案,基于云服务器的搭建及配置方案详解

本文详细介绍了基于云服务器的搭建及配置方案,涵盖了从服务器选择、环境搭建到配置优化等关键步骤,旨在帮助读者全面掌握云服务器搭建与配置的技巧。...

本文详细介绍了基于云服务器的搭建及配置方案,涵盖了从服务器选择、环境搭建到配置优化等关键步骤,旨在帮助读者全面掌握云服务器搭建与配置的技巧。

随着互联网技术的飞速发展,云服务器因其高效、稳定、灵活的特点,逐渐成为企业及个人用户的首选,本文将详细阐述云服务器的搭建及配置方案,帮助您快速掌握云服务器的基本操作,实现高效、稳定的业务部署。

云服务器搭建

1、选择云服务提供商

您需要选择一家可靠的云服务提供商,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等,在选择时,可以从以下几个方面进行考虑:

(1)服务稳定性:了解服务商的故障率、故障恢复时间等指标。

(2)价格:比较不同服务商的价格,选择性价比高的方案。

云服务器搭建及配置方案,基于云服务器的搭建及配置方案详解

(3)技术支持:了解服务商的技术支持服务,确保在遇到问题时能及时得到解决。

2、创建云服务器

选择好服务商后,登录云服务平台,按照以下步骤创建云服务器:

(1)选择服务器类型:根据您的业务需求,选择合适的云服务器类型,如标准型、计算型、内存型等。

(2)配置服务器规格:根据业务需求,配置CPU、内存、硬盘等硬件资源。

(3)设置网络带宽:根据业务需求,设置公网带宽。

(4)设置安全组:配置安全组规则,控制访问权限。

(5)选择地域和可用区:选择服务器部署的地域和可用区,确保业务的高可用性。

(6)设置登录密码:设置服务器登录密码,用于后续登录操作。

3、配置云服务器

创建好云服务器后,您需要进行以下配置:

(1)远程登录:使用SSH客户端(如PuTTY)连接到云服务器,输入设置的密码。

云服务器搭建及配置方案,基于云服务器的搭建及配置方案详解

(2)更新系统:执行“sudo apt-get update”和“sudo apt-get upgrade”命令,更新系统软件包。

(3)安装软件:根据业务需求,安装相应的软件,如Web服务器、数据库等。

云服务器配置

1、配置Web服务器

以Apache为例,配置Web服务器步骤如下:

(1)安装Apache:执行“sudo apt-get install apache2”命令安装Apache。

(2)设置虚拟主机:编辑“/etc/apache2/sites-available/000-default.conf”文件,配置虚拟主机。

(3)启用虚拟主机:执行“sudo a2ensite default-ssl.conf”命令启用SSL。

(4)重启Apache:执行“sudo systemctl restart apache2”命令重启Apache。

2、配置数据库

以MySQL为例,配置数据库步骤如下:

(1)安装MySQL:执行“sudo apt-get install mysql-server”命令安装MySQL。

(2)设置root密码:执行“sudo mysql_secure_installation”命令设置root密码。

云服务器搭建及配置方案,基于云服务器的搭建及配置方案详解

(3)创建数据库:执行“sudo mysql -u root -p”命令登录MySQL,创建所需数据库。

(4)创建用户:执行“CREATE USER 'username'@'localhost' IDENTIFIED BY 'password';”命令创建用户。

(5)授权用户:执行“GRANT ALL PRIVILEGES ON databasename.* TO 'username'@'localhost';”命令授权用户。

(6)刷新权限:执行“FLUSH PRIVILEGES;”命令刷新权限。

3、配置安全组

根据业务需求,配置安全组规则,控制访问权限,以下是一些常见的安全组配置:

(1)允许访问80端口:允许外部访问Web服务。

(2)允许访问3306端口:允许外部访问MySQL数据库。

(3)允许访问22端口:允许SSH远程登录。

本文详细介绍了云服务器的搭建及配置方案,包括选择服务商、创建服务器、配置Web服务器、数据库和安全组等,通过学习本文,您将能够快速掌握云服务器的基本操作,实现高效、稳定的业务部署,在实际操作过程中,请根据自身需求进行调整和优化。

黑狐家游戏

发表评论

最新文章